packages/jsondiffpatch/src/pipe.ts
import type Context from './contexts/context.js';
import type Processor from './processor.js';
import type { Filter } from './types.js';
// eslint-disable-next-line @typescript-eslint/no-explicit-any
class Pipe<TContext extends Context<any>> {
name: string;
filters: Filter<TContext>[];
processor?: Processor;
debug?: boolean;
resultCheck?: ((context: TContext) => void) | null;
constructor(name: string) {
this.name = name;
this.filters = [];
}
process(input: TContext) {
if (!this.processor) {
throw new Error('add this pipe to a processor before using it');
}
const debug = this.debug;
const length = this.filters.length;
const context = input;
for (let index = 0; index < length; index++) {
const filter = this.filters[index];
if (debug) {
this.log(`filter: ${filter.filterName}`);
}
filter(context);
if (typeof context === 'object' && context.exiting) {
context.exiting = false;
break;
}
}
if (!context.next && this.resultCheck) {
this.resultCheck(context);
}
}
log(msg: string) {
console.log(`[jsondiffpatch] ${this.name} pipe, ${msg}`);
}
append(...args: Filter<TContext>[]) {
this.filters.push(...args);
return this;
}
prepend(...args: Filter<TContext>[]) {
this.filters.unshift(...args);
return this;
}
indexOf(filterName: string) {
if (!filterName) {
throw new Error('a filter name is required');
}
for (let index = 0; index < this.filters.length; index++) {
const filter = this.filters[index];
if (filter.filterName === filterName) {
return index;
}
}
throw new Error(`filter not found: ${filterName}`);
}
list() {
return this.filters.map((f) => f.filterName);
}
after(filterName: string, ...params: Filter<TContext>[]) {
const index = this.indexOf(filterName);
this.filters.splice(index + 1, 0, ...params);
return this;
}
before(filterName: string, ...params: Filter<TContext>[]) {
const index = this.indexOf(filterName);
this.filters.splice(index, 0, ...params);
return this;
}
replace(filterName: string, ...params: Filter<TContext>[]) {
const index = this.indexOf(filterName);
this.filters.splice(index, 1, ...params);
return this;
}
remove(filterName: string) {
const index = this.indexOf(filterName);
this.filters.splice(index, 1);
return this;
}
clear() {
this.filters.length = 0;
return this;
}
shouldHaveResult(should?: boolean) {
if (should === false) {
this.resultCheck = null;
return;
}
if (this.resultCheck) {
return;
}
this.resultCheck = (context) => {
if (!context.hasResult) {
console.log(context);
const error: Error & { noResult?: boolean } = new Error(
`${this.name} failed`,
);
error.noResult = true;
throw error;
}
};
return this;
}
}
export default Pipe;
